Intel Desktop Board DB85FL Technical Product Specification Table 32 lists the BIOS Setup program menu features. Table 32. Intel Visual BIOS Setup Display Areas Home 1 Home 2 Displays processor, graphics, memory, and configuration with quick launch to tuning, UEFI apps, BIOS update, and system profiles Environmental monitoring display and attached SATA devices Home 3 System, desktop board, chassis, and processor information Main Devices & Peripherals Displays processor, memory, configuration, event log, date, and time Configures advanced features available through the chipset and other discrete controllers Cooling Real-time system monitoring, adjust fan speeds, set temperature set points, and define system voltage settings continued Table 32. Intel Visual BIOS Setup Display Areas (continued) Performance Displays and Configures Memory, Graphics, Bus, and Processor overrides Security Sets passwords and security features Power Configures power management features and power supply controls Boot Selects boot options and boot display options Exit Saves or discards changes to Setup program options Table 33 lists the function keys available for menu screens.
